Roberto Gambini is a scholar working on Geophysics, Mechanics of Materials and Earth-Surface Processes. According to data from OpenAlex, Roberto Gambini has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 426 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Geophysics, 5 papers in Mechanics of Materials and 3 papers in Earth-Surface Processes. Recurrent topics in Roberto Gambini's work include earthquake and tectonic studies (9 papers), Geological and Geochemical Analysis (8 papers) and Geological and Geophysical Studies Worldwide (6 papers). Roberto Gambini is often cited by papers focused on earthquake and tectonic studies (9 papers), Geological and Geochemical Analysis (8 papers) and Geological and Geophysical Studies Worldwide (6 papers). Roberto Gambini coll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Spain and Austria. Roberto Gambini's co-authors include M. Tozzi, Stefano Mazzoli, Emanuele Tondi, Giuseppe Cello, Fabrizio Storti, P. Shiner, L. Mattioni, Andrea Billi, Andrew F. Read and Josep Antón Muñoz and has published in prestigious journals such as Tectonics, Energies and Journal of the Geological Society.
